Full-time

Senior Software Engineer at Tactable

Posted by Tactable • toronto, on, Canada

📍 toronto, on 🕒 June 01, 2026

About the Role

Be part of transformation at Tactable as a Senior Software Engineer focused on cloud, data, and APIs in a hybrid environment. Build scalable systems and mentor teams while driving impactful projects.

Tactable invites applications for a hands-on Senior Software Engineer role. This individual will engage in end-to-end engineering, overseeing back-end systems, data pipelines, and microservices integration. Collaborate with cross-functional teams and lead high-availability system designs that matter.

Key Responsibilities: • Build high-performance backend systems using Python • Design distributed data pipelines with Spark and Kafka • Develop microservices for streaming and batch data • Integrate complex data systems using ETL/ELT processes • Collaborate with frontend teams to support API integration

Requirements: • 8+ years of software/data engineering experience • Advanced expertise in Python and service-oriented architecture • Experience with Spark, Kafka, and d...

Ready to Apply?

Submit your application today and take the next step in your career journey with Tactable.

Apply Now